Foul Tip
What is the rule on a 3rd strike foul tip if the ball gets lodged in the catchers armpit without hitting his glove first. What if the ball hits his glove then bounces off his mask and then is caught? Is the hitter still out

In 1st it is a foul ball not a foul tip. In 2nd it is a foul tip and he is out. |
If it hits the hand or glove first, doesn't hit the ground, and is eventually gotten under control by the catcher, it's a foul tip.

actually if the ball goes directly from bat to glove, doesn't hit the ground and is eventually gotten under control by any defensive player, it's a foul tip.
|
3apples,
While your statement is correct for a game played under FED rules, it is incorrect for a game played under OBR rules. JM |

OBR/LL
1) What is the rule on a 3rd strike foul tip if the ball gets lodged in the catchers armpit without hitting his glove first. Not a foul tip. Foul Ball. 2) What if the ball hits his glove then bounces off his mask and then is caught? Not a foul tip: Third Strike Caught. Is the hitter still out? Yes. Not entitled to try for 1st. |
